AN INTRODUCTION TO BEEKEEPING This 118 minute, five segment video packed with information about the entire beekeeping season. It will take you from assembling equipment to harvesting honey and everything in between, including a segment on pests an diseases as well as one on beekeeping informational resources. This video is not only great for the beginning or prospective beekeeper but it also makes a handsome and valuable addition to any beekeeping club library or video collection. It's fantastic for training as well public demonstrations. This is the first in a series of Beekeeping videos by Beekeeper E. E. (Ed) Mabesoone and is informative, entertaining and easy to understand. Graphic review included.

BACK TO THE BASICS OF INSPECTION This 28 minute video teaches you how to look at your colonies three dimensionally. It shows you how to do a more complete inspection in less time and with less work, giving you more time to enjoy your bees. Once you’ve learned to do a complete basic inspection with this easy to follow video you’ll be surprised how your colonies will flourish. This video is informative, entertaining and easy to understand! Graphic review included.

TWO FOR ONE SPLITS & DIVIDES This 17 minute video will help you learn how easy it is to increase the number of colonies you have by making splits and divides instead of purchasing more expensive package bees. After watching our beekeeper actually split a colony, we'll take you through a review of important things to remember about making a split. Then we'll take you back to the apiary to check on the splits. This video is informative, interesting and easy to understand.This video shows you how to double or even triple the number of colonies you have in just one season without buying another package. Graphic review included.

PACKAGE BEES THE EASY WAY This 26 minute video is just packed with information for the beginning beekeeper as well as some get back to the basics hints for the old hand. Watch as our on camera beekeeper installs two packages of bees. Each one in a different manner. We'll show you different ways to install the bees, the queen, and the use of different feeders. After you've seen the actual installations we'll take you through a review of what we did and why we did it. Then you'll go back to the colony for a three day inspection to make sure the bees have released the queen and to remove the queen cage.Watch and learn as our professional beekeeper shows you several different ways to install, inspect and feed your new package bees. Graphic review included.

    THE ART OF REQUEENING This 16 minute video will show you the proper way to requeen honeybee colonies. We’ll show you a newly captured swarm being requeened. The old queen will be removed and a new Buckfast queen will be installed to replace her. After a graphic review of important facts to remember about requeening we will return to the apiary to remove the queen cages and check on the new queens progress. The video is interesting, informative and easy to understand! A must have for the beginning beekeeper or ANY beekeeper for that matter! Graphic review included.
